France

In France, the surname "Ecuer" has a relatively high incidence, with 174 individuals bearing this surname. The name has been traced back to medieval times when it was used to refer to someone who had a strong connection to horses. The word "écuer" in French means "squire" or "groom," indicating that the original bearers of this surname may have been involved in horse-related professions. Over time, the surname "Ecuer" has become more widespread in France, with many families carrying on this ancestral name.
